Transaction 59020f594f9c3e03ae5324d1c28eed64b707abd5160a10312a0db7beb960d145

2 Input
2 Outputs
  • 59020f594f9c3e03ae5324d1c28eed64b707abd5160a10312a0db7beb960d145:0
  • value  29683
    address  bc1qg0dc3sctfvgalug3k0gnxe62sprn0wkkfy25vv
  • 59020f594f9c3e03ae5324d1c28eed64b707abd5160a10312a0db7beb960d145:1
  • value  16555776
    address  1FxQFwXPhgfpN43MW6RttLcxDwQAXsGb2q